What is the UK Tenant Application Form?
The UK Tenant Application Form serves as a vital document for prospective tenants and guarantors who wish to rent properties in the UK. This form is necessary for assessing suitability and gathering essential information required for the rental process. The application collects various personal details, employment information, and also requires the signatures of both tenants and guarantors, ensuring all parties acknowledge their responsibilities.
It is crucial for applicants to provide accurate information, as incomplete or misleading submissions can lead to delays or rejections in the application process. Understanding the details collected will help candidates prepare their documents more effectively.
Purpose and Benefits of the UK Tenant Application Form
This application form is essential as it enables landlords to evaluate potential tenants thoroughly. By standardizing the rental application process, landlords can make informed decisions based on tenant qualifications, ensuring a transparent rental agreement. For tenants, the form ensures clarity and accountability, aiding in the documentation and organization of their rental history.
Additionally, applicants are often required to pay a non-refundable application fee, typically equivalent to one week's rent. This fee reinforces the commitment of the tenant while helping landlords manage their application process effectively.
Who Needs the UK Tenant Application Form?
Primarily, the UK Tenant Application Form must be filled out by both tenants and their guarantors. Tenants may include individuals or families looking to rent a property, while guarantors—who must typically be homeowners—play a crucial role in backing the rental application. Their eligibility can influence the approval of the application, serving as safety net for landlords.
Understanding the significance of roles within this process helps streamline the application. A well-prepared guarantor can strengthen the chances of securing a rental property.

What are the eligibility requirements for using the UK Tenant Application Form?
To use the UK Tenant Application Form, prospective tenants should be at least 18 years old and provide necessary identification and income verification. Guarantors must be homeowners in full-time employment.

What supporting documents are needed with the application?
You should provide proof of identity, such as a passport or driving license, along with recent payslips or a bank statement to verify your income as part of the application process.
